EDIT: Got it working, copied the settings from another higher spec Ranger and it was the settings for the cruise control button in SCCM that were the issue..

I'm in South Africa and I'm trying to get the same thing going here, my as-built is totally different from yours posted here, all of them and I'm now stuck with different errors depending on what I change.

So I bought the steering wheel from a wrecked Ranger of similar year to mine and fitted the wheel complete with the buttons on both sides.

Enabled it in the following modules:

IPC: 2 places - Adjustable speed limiter and cruise control switch
SCCM: No changes, Switch pack still set to Ford 5 Way only
PCM: Cruise Control
BdyCM - Collision mitigation with braking - Checking this option to "with cruise control" took away the switch pack error and incompatible module configuration errors from the SCCM and gave me a single error in ABS module for module configuration incompatible. I haven't found any reliable spreadsheet detailing the as-built settings on the Rangers built in South Africa, but I'm sure that the wiring and settings are all the same, it's only the steering wheel and related buttons which swap sides but remain wired the same.

My cluster is identical to the one OP posted except it is only in Km/h

Well after a thorough information gathering online:clock:, I managed to find a way to add CC even without paying for an other steering wheel (also I don't like leather and grey paint).
What I did was to enable it by just buying the left switch pack which has part no. 1945174 / eb3t-9e740-fb3ja6
and by adding 3 cables from the switch pack to the connector on the clock spring (took me some real investigatior and electronics skills to guess the pins:inspect:) because Ford decided to save 0,01 cent on that wiring manufatcured in China as stated on the production tag.
Then it was just matter of using Forscan to change the lines with which I obtained from an asbuilt file of a VIN found online belonging to an XLT Ranger (has cc from factory).
I also made an opening on the left side for the new switch pack (since ford doesn't sell those without the wheel) and it looks cooler IMHO.
